
A 10-year-old Palestinian boy was discovered hidden inside a shopping cart under bags of fruit and vegetables while a couple was attempting to get him into Spain from Morocco , according to officials.
The incident happened around 1 p.m. on Monday at the Beni-Enzar border crossing in the Spanish autonomous city of Melilla , located on the northwest coast of Africa.
Agents stopped the couple when they realized the shopping cart had an above-normal weight and then proceeded to inspect it.

Dec. 11 (UPI) -- A Massachusetts teen required help from firefighters with power tools after her fingers got stuck in the holes of a shopping cart.
Olivia Harol posted a video to TikTok showing what happened when she attempted to put her fingers through the holes of a shopping cart at the Marshalls store in Canton.
Harol said she spent about 15 minutes trying to free herself before her friends solicited help from store employees.

Police said brazen thieves with no holiday cheer in their hearts have made off with more than 100 grocery shopping carts from a Hampton Bays King Kullen supermarket in the past two weeks.

Carts typically cost anywhere from $75 to $150 each. Some take them for convenience and abandon them, creating environmental concerns.
“It is a significant loss. At $150 per cart, we’re talking a $15,000 loss,” Southampton Town Police Chief Steve Skrynecki said.

Amazon has opened 24 of its Amazon Go stores , which use cameras and artificial intelligence to see what you’ve taken off shelves and charge you as you walk out.
Some startups such as San Francisco-based Grabango are closely mimicking Amazon’s approach of using AI-powered cameras mounted in ceilings to identify what you’ve removed from a shelf and then charge you for those items.
But others are trying an entirely different route to skipping the checkout: smart shopping carts. These companies have added cameras and sensors to the carts, and are using AI to tell what you’ve placed in them. A built-in scale weighs items, in case you have to pay by the pound for an item. Customers pay by entering a credit card, or by using Apple Pay or Google Pay.

Falls from the cart are among the leading causes of head injuries to young children. How can you ensure your trip to the store doesn't lead to a trip to the emergency room? The experts at Safe-Strap, the inventors of the shopping cart seat belt, offer the following tips.
• It can be tempting to try to balance your infant carrier on top of your shopping cart, as the carrier may appear like it's designed to fit there. Be advised, this isn't the case. Use a shopping cart outfitted with a docking station, such as Safe-Dock, the first universal infant carrier docking station for shopping carts. This provides an easy transition of baby carrier from car to cart, no matter what the make and model of your U.S.-purchased car seat.
